The Week in the Flooring Industry with Floor Focus Publisher Kemp Harr (33:27)

The Week in the Flooring Industry with Floor Focus Publisher Kemp Harr (33:27)

April 25, 2007—Kemp Harr, Publisher of Floor Focus magazine looks at the ceramic and stone show Coverings 2007, which was held last week at Chicago’s McCormick Place. Discussed are the preliminary attendance figures and increases in the architect and design and retail categories, increases in exhibitor participation and some of the event and product introduction highlights of the show. Also discussed: Mohawk’s 1Q earnings, which rose 14%, and some of the comments made during the company’s conference call as well as the licensing agreements between Unilin and Valinge and Unilin and Beaulieu International.

John Simonson on the Industry's New & Revised Websites - (62:00)

John Simonson on the Industry's New & Revised Websites - (62:00)

April 20, 2007—John Simonson, President, Webstream Dynamics, in a FloorRadio archives presentation talks about some of the changes that have occurred on the Internet within the floorcovering sector and the growing level of sophistication of consumers online as well as the general likes, dislikes, and growing level of traffic on the Internet. Simonson also begins his review of the new or recently revised websites shawfloor.com, carpetone.com and wfca.org. Simonson discusses some of the similarities and and the advantages and disadvantages of including price and the possible limitations industry players may exersise with regard to including price on industry websites.
